 * “The PLF plugin consists of two parts: a general plugin part and a must use plugin[…]
   must use plugin (plugin load filter [plf-filter]) is automatically updated when
   the PLF settings screen is opened after a plugin update.”
   Cool, this explains
   why I had to enter the plugin settings and click a button to make it work after
   reactivation.I updated the plugin. Now images can be added in the classic editor,
   with links and all.Problem solved! Thank you so much [@enomoto-celtislab](https://wordpress.org/support/users/enomoto-celtislab/)!
